Presence Detection and Space Optimization
Smart carpets use pressure-sensitive fibers to detect the presence and movement of people. This data can be used to optimize space usage, improve energy efficiency, and enhance security. Our recent installation at GlobalTech Corp resulted in a 22% improvement in space utilization and a 15% reduction in energy costs.Indoor Navigation
For large office complexes, smart carpets can provide indoor navigation, guiding employees and visitors to their destinations through subtle LED indicators or smartphone integration. This feature has been particularly praised in sprawling campuses, with one client reporting a 30% reduction in time wasted on finding meeting rooms.Safety and Emergency Response
In emergency situations, smart carpets can illuminate escape routes or detect falls, especially crucial for offices with older employees or those with mobility issues. The quick response time has been shown to potentially reduce accident severity by up to 40%.Environmental Control
By detecting occupancy and foot traffic patterns, smart carpets can communicate with HVAC and lighting systems to optimize energy use. A study conducted in our test offices showed energy savings of up to 25% when smart carpets were integrated with building management systems.Noise Reduction and Acoustic Optimization
Beyond traditional sound absorption, smart carpets can actively cancel out noise in specific areas, creating quiet zones in open-plan offices. Employees at InnovateTech reported a 50% increase in concentration levels after the installation of our acoustic-optimizing smart carpets.Health and Wellness Monitoring
Some advanced smart carpet systems can monitor walking patterns to detect early signs of health issues or potential fall risks. While primarily used in healthcare settings, this feature is gaining traction in corporate wellness programs.Data Analytics for Office Design
The data collected by smart carpets provide invaluable insights into how office spaces are used, informing future design decisions. One architecture firm reported that data from smart carpets led to a 35% improvement in employee satisfaction with new office layouts.
However, as with any technological advancement, the integration of smart carpets comes with challenges. Privacy concerns are at the forefront, and it's crucial to implement these systems with robust data protection measures. At TechFloor Innovations, we've developed advanced encryption protocols that ensure all data collected is anonymized and securely stored.
The cost of implementation can also be a concern for some businesses. However, our case studies have shown that the long-term benefits in energy savings, improved productivity, and space optimization often result in a return on investment within 18-24 months.
